I just got a cable from Gomadic.com. I have a Motorola v60c with Verizon Wireless. I have the internet on my phone service. ($5 a month). I connected the cable up to my Axim & cellphone, set the connections the way Gomadic recommended for my carrier. It dials out & I'm connected to the internet on the Axim. It works great. The speed could be a little better but other than that..... connecting is simple & retrieving emails (created new service for this.... not using Activesync) works great.

I'm using Verizon Wireless. They offer a free Mobile Office phone number to use (#777) to gain free access to the Internet using a PDA or Laptop. Or, you can use your own Dial-Up ISP if you want to.

Cable connect to Cell

I have Verizon wireless as my Cell service. I added internet access onto it for $5 a month. I configured a connection on my Axim as the cable (Gomadic) manufacturer recommended. I was then able to connect to the internet through my cellphone. I could then get email, view websites, etc. as if I had dialed out on a modem. The Axim is using my cellphone as a modem.
